Step-by-Step: How to Set Up Windows 11 Wallpaper Slideshow

Setting up a Windows 11 wallpaper slideshow requires no advanced skills—just a few clicks in your settings. We'll cover the built-in method, which works on all editions of Windows 11, including Home and Pro. Ensure your system is updated to the latest version for the smoothest experience.

Step 1: Access Personalization Settings

👆 Start by right-clicking on an empty spot on your desktop and selecting Personalize from the context menu. Alternatively, head to Settings (press Windows key + I) and click Personalization in the left sidebar. This opens the hub for all things visual in Windows 11.

Step 2: Navigate to Background Options

In the Personalization menu, select Background. Here, you'll see options like Picture, Slideshow, and Solid color. Click on Slideshow to activate the feature. If it's not immediately visible, toggle from "Picture" to "Slideshow" under the Choose your background dropdown.

This is where the fun begins—Windows 11 lets you pull images from any folder on your PC or even cloud storage like OneDrive.

Step 3: Select Your Image Folder

Under "Choose a folder containing pictures," click Browse and navigate to the folder with your desired images. Pro tip: Organize a dedicated folder with high-resolution photos (at least 1920x1080 for best results) to avoid pixelation. Windows 11 supports formats like JPEG, PNG, and even GIFs for subtle animations.

Step 4: Customize Slideshow Settings

Scroll down to the Slideshow section for tweaks that make all the difference:

  • Fit picture to screen: Ensures images scale perfectly without distortion—ideal for mixed aspect ratios.
  • Change picture every: Set the interval from 10 minutes to 1 day. For a lively feel, try 30 minutes; for calm, go longer.
  • Shuffle the picture order: Enable this for random rotation, keeping surprises in store each time you log in.
  • Turn on and off the slideshow: Perfect for presentations or when you need a static background temporarily.

Troubleshooting Common Issues with Windows 11 Wallpaper Slideshow

Even the best setups hit snags. If your wallpaper slideshow isn't changing:

Issue Solution
Slideshow stops or skips images Check folder permissions—ensure the folder isn't read-only. Run the Photos app troubleshooter via Settings > System > Troubleshoot.
Images appear blurry Use high-res photos and enable "Fit picture to screen." Update your graphics drivers from the manufacturer's site.
No slideshow option visible Update Windows 11 via Settings > Windows Update. If on an older build, the feature might be limited—consider the latest feature update.
